Retail Roundup: Gann Ranch Shopping, Dining and Entertainment

Gann Ranch is located in the peaceful, scenic environs near Cedar Park, and it’s also convenient to great shopping, dining, and entertainment.

There are three major shopping centers within about 15 minutes of Gann Ranch. Together, they represent more than 350 department stores, restaurants, movie theaters, and more. Shopping for groceries and daily needs is also easy with a nearby HEB about 5 minutes from the neighborhood.

Fashion, Food and Fun at 1890 Ranch

With 1890 Ranch just ten minutes away, neighbors can enjoy more than 80 stores, services, restaurants and entertainment options. Retailers include SuperTarget, Academy Sports, Hobby Lobby, Bealls, Charming Charlie, Claire’s Boutique, James Avery Jewelry, Ross, and Plato’s Closet, to name a few. For movie lovers, the center also hosts a 12-screen Cinemark Theater that shows the latest Hollywood fare. After the movie, couples can go to Starbucks to share a double tall skinny latte and relax in the coffeehouse’s comfortable ambiance.

Some of the many popular restaurants at 1890 Ranch include Logan’s Roadhouse, LongHorn Steakhouse and Mighty Fine Burgers. Two More Regional Malls with over 275 Stores and Restaurants

Lakeline Mall, also about 10 minutes away, features more than 150 stores and restaurants. Here, shoppers enjoy a spacious mall including anchor stores Dillard’s, Macy’s and Sears, in addition to retailers such as American Eagle Outfitters, Bath & Body Works, Express, Foot Locker, Fredericks’ of Hollywood, Gap, Image, Lakeline Day Spa, Lane Bryant, The Limited, Old Navy, and JCPenney. The mall also has a Cinemark multiplex movie theater for date night or family fun.

Round Rock Premium Outlets center, under 20 minutes from home, is an outdoor mall that has 125 stores, including Banana Republic, Coach, Polo Ralph Lauren, Burberry, Ann Taylor, and Cotton On — and all offer outstanding discounted prices and bargains on their wares every day. Across the street from the mall is the only IKEA in the Central Texas area. IKEA offers contemporary Danish design-influenced furniture, with everything in stock and in convenient flatpacks.
